#0ab597 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0ab597 is composed of 3.9% red, 71%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.6%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 169.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 37.5%. #0ab597 color hex could be obtained by blending #14ffff with #006b2f.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#0ab597 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0ab597 has RGB values of R:10, G:181,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 701847.

Shades and Tints of #0ab597
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010e0b is the darkest color, while #fafff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0ab597
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b6463 is the less saturated color, while #03bc9c is the most saturated one.
